What happens
The Resident is an American medical drama television series that aired on Fox from January 21, 2018, to January 17, 2023. The series premiered on Fox as a mid-season replacement during the 2017–18 television season. The series focuses on the lives and duties of staff members at fictional Chastain Park Memorial Hospital in Atlanta, Georgia, with generally a critical eye into current issues of medical practice and tensions in the healthcare industry. Created by Amy Holden Jones, Hayley Schore, and Roshan Sethi, the series was purchased by Fox from Showtime in 2017. In May 2017, Fox ordered the project to series, with a 14-episode season order. The series premiere was a lead-out to the Vikings-Eagles NFC Championship Game. In May 2021, the series was renewed for a fifth season, which premiered on September 21, 2021. In May 2022, the series was renewed for a sixth season, which premiered on September 20, 2022. In April 2023, the series was canceled after six seasons. (from Wikipedia, CC BY-SA)
